Retired U.S. Marine · Founder and CEO
Founder, CEO, and chairman of Albers Aerospace, retired U.S. Marine Corps Colonel John Albers brings more than 24 years of military service and a career shaped by flight test, defense acquisition, and people-first leadership.
A graduate of the U.S. Naval Test Pilot School, John was the first Marine selected to command the U.S. Navy’s full-spectrum flight-test squadron. He has flown more than 5,000 hours in 69 aircraft types, including more than 140 combat hours supporting Operation Iraqi Freedom.
Today he leads Albers Aerospace across its industrial, defense, and innovation businesses. The company has grown to more than 450 teammates nationwide around a culture of inspiring others, delivering value, putting people first, and making an impact.
Bodybuilding champion · Entrepreneur
A two-time Arnold Classic champion with 13 IFBB professional victories and a runner-up finish at the 2009 Mr. Olympia, Branch Warren became known as “The Texas Titan” for his discipline, intensity, and relentless work.
Born in Tyler, Texas, Branch began bodybuilding as a teenager and went on to make eight Mr. Olympia appearances. His powerful physique and hard-training style made him one of the most recognizable professional bodybuilders of his era.
Since retiring from competition in 2015, he has continued to promote shows, mentor athletes, support the fitness community, and build business ventures including Wicked Cutz. Away from the gym, he values family and the Texas outdoors.
